Tips for Picking Music in Advertising

Choosing music for ads needs insight into your customers, brand identity, and the campaign’s message. The music should:

  • Match the mood – energetic, mellow, serious, or light-hearted, depending on the ad’s style.
  • Reflect your brand’s values – classic, contemporary, cutting-edge, or reliable.
  • Be culturally appropriate – matching the audience’s tastes.
  • Support the narrative – not distracting from the visuals.

Pros and Cons of Music Options

You can opt for custom music or pre-existing songs. Original music provides a unique sound, but can be require more resources. Licensed music is ready-made and familiar dynamic music for advertising videos but needs careful copyright management.

Popular Music Genres for Advertising

Music styles shape perception. Commonly used genres include:

  • Mainstream tunes – upbeat and relatable.
  • Orchestral – sophisticated and elegant.
  • Soulful tunes – relaxed and stylish.
  • Synth-based – tech-savvy and vibrant.
  • Folk – simple and heartfelt.

Where to Get Music for Commercials

There are several ways to obtain music for advertising:

  • Online music marketplaces – websites offering pre-made tracks.
  • Bespoke music creation – hiring composers for tailored pieces.
  • Collaborations with artists – supporting independent artists.

Music Licensing Tips

Securing the correct music licences is essential to prevent infringement. This includes synchronisation rights, public performance rights, and mechanical rights, depending on where and how the ad is shown.
